Use the enclosed cleaning brush or a vacuum g cleaner to remove any lint and dust from the race and its surrounding area. a b a Cleaning brush b Race • Do not apply oil to the race or bobbin case. Insert the bobbin case so that the S mark on h the bobbin case aligns with the z mark on machine as shown below. CAUTION ● Never use a bobbin case that is scratched, otherwise the upper thread may become tangled, the needle may break, or sewing performance may suffer. For a new bobbin case, contact your nearest authorized service center. ● Be sure that the bobbin case is correctly installed, otherwise the needle may break.
